Solution for 7(x+3)+9=7x+4 equation:


Simplifying
7(x + 3) + 9 = 7x + 4

Reorder the terms:
7(3 + x) + 9 = 7x + 4
(3 * 7 + x * 7) + 9 = 7x + 4
(21 + 7x) + 9 = 7x + 4

Reorder the terms:
21 + 9 + 7x = 7x + 4

Combine like terms: 21 + 9 = 30
30 + 7x = 7x + 4

Reorder the terms:
30 + 7x = 4 + 7x

Add '-7x' to each side of the equation.
30 + 7x + -7x = 4 + 7x + -7x

Combine like terms: 7x + -7x = 0
30 + 0 = 4 + 7x + -7x
30 = 4 + 7x + -7x

Combine like terms: 7x + -7x = 0
30 = 4 + 0
30 = 4

Solving
30 = 4

Couldn't find a variable to solve for.

This equation is invalid, the left and right sides are not equal, therefore there is no solution.
